Chapter 6 - Review - Concept Check - Page 526: 3

Answer

$(a)$ $s=r\theta$ $(b)$ $A=\frac{1}{2}r^2\theta$

Work Step by Step

$(a)$ The length $s$ of an arc that subtends a central angle of $\theta$ radians is simply $r\theta$, as we learned from the chapter $6$ $s=r\theta$ $(b)$ The are $A$ of a sector with central angle of $\theta$ radians is $\frac{1}{2}r^2\theta$. Also mentioned in the chapter. $A=\frac{1}{2}r^2\theta$
